Job Description
Key responsibilities for the Commissioning Specialist include:
- Lead the commissioning, procurement, and contract management of a portfolio of adult services, including services for older people, people with learning disabilities, physical disabilities, autism, and mental health needs.
- Use data, evidence, and stakeholder feedback to shape service models, assess population needs, and inform strategic planning.
- Work closely with operational teams, providers, NHS partners, and voluntary sector organisations to co-produce and co-design innovative service solutions.
- Drive quality assurance and continuous improvement through robust performance monitoring, service reviews, and contract management.
- Ensure commissioned services deliver value for money, meet statutory requirements, and align with priorities and legislative frameworks.
- Lead and contribute to market shaping activity to ensure a sustainable and responsive provider market.
- Manage budgets effectively and support the delivery of efficiency targets through service transformation.
